SACD

PyTorch implementation on: Seeing your sleep stage: cross-modal distillation from EEG to infrared video.
(A cross-modal distillation method based on infrared video and EEG signals)

Introduction

We propose a novel cross-modal methodology (SACD) to solve the previous barriers, enabling point-of-care sleep stage monitoring at home.

To enable the developments of point-of-care healthcare research and distillation methods from clinical to visual modality, to our best knowledge, we are the first to collect a large-scale cross-modal distillation dataset, namely $S^3VE$.

Getting Started

Requirmenets:

  • python >= 3.6.10
  • pytorch >= 1.1.0
  • FFmpeg, FFprobe
  • Numpy
  • Sklearn
  • Pandas
  • openpyxl
  • mne=='0.20.7'
